ClearPath DS-120 Clinical Study Protocol
Description

The goal of this study is to measure lens fluorescence in normal subjects at various chronological ages that could serves as a guide to clinicians in determining changes in eye health. A measure of lens fluorescence can be used by clinicians as an indication of degenerative changes occurring in the lens of the eye.

Neuro-ocular Baselines in a Sports Setting
Description

Rebion (Rebiscan, Inc) has developed a noninvasive, handheld device that uses retinal birefringence scanning (RBS) to rapidly assess eye fixation and retinal integrity in adults and children. The proprietary technology uses a scanned annulus of polarized laser light to create a signature that confirms central fixation within seconds. The project described herein aims to provide accurate assessment of brain dysfunction in TBI (Traumatic Brain Injury) patients through the use of the developed device, which is called the Head and Intraocular Trauma Test (HITT) device.

A Safety, Tolerability and Efficacy Study of Veligrotug (VRDN 001) in Healthy Volunteers and Participants with Thyroid Eye Disease (TED) ( THRIVE )
Description

Please note that Phase 1/2 (HV \&amp ; TED MAD) cohorts and Phase 3 component (THRIVE) - recruitment is complete. The investigational drug, veligrotug (VRDN-001), is a monoclonal antibody that inhibits the activity of a cell surface receptor called insulin-like growth factor-1 receptor (IGF-1R). Inhibition of IGF-1R may help to reduce the inflammation and associated tissue swelling that occurs in patients with thyroid eye disease (TED). This clinical trial will evaluate the safety, tolerability and pharmacokinetics (the concentration of drug in the blood over time) of veligrotug (VRDN-001) in healthy volunteers (HV) and in patients with TED. Study participants with TED will also be evaluated over time for changes in their signs and symptoms of TED compared to their baseline measurements.
